Join Our Team as a Branch Manager at Connells in Faversham

Why Join Us

We're seeking a dynamic and results-driven Branch Manager, with a proven track record of managing a successful estate agency team whilst hitting multiple KPI metrics, to lead our residential sales team at Connells.

As a Branch Manager, you'll oversee the operations of the branch, driving sales, managing staff, and ensuring exceptional customer service delivery.

What We Offer

Competitive OTE of £50,000 with Uncapped Commission. Clear Career Progression. Industry-Leading Training and Development. Opportunities to Compete for Top Achievers Awards. Company Car. Comprehensive Benefits Package.

Your Role

As a Branch Manager, you'll be responsible for the overall performance of the branch. This includes leading and motivating a team of sales agents, setting and achieving sales targets, and fostering a culture of excellence in customer service. You'll also be actively involved in listing properties and maintaining strong relationships with clients.

What We're Looking For

Proven experience in a managerial role within the real estate industry. Strong leadership and people management skills. Exceptional customer care/service experience. Resilient, positive, organized, numerate, and detail-oriented. Excellent verbal and written communication skills. Estate Agency experience necessary. Must hold a Full UK driving license.

About Connells Group

Connells Group, one of the largest and most successful estate agency and property services providers in the UK. Founded in 1936 and with a network or over 1,250 branches, the Group combines residential sales and lettings expertise with a range of services including new homes, mortgage services, surveying, conveyancing and more!
